Some general rules I think need to be followed to take a jumpsuit into office wear:
Choose a jumpsuit that is simple and basic. No sparkles. Nothing with a deep-v – keep ‘the girls’ workplace appropriate.
Cover up with a jacket, blazer or cardi to create a more conservative look and neckline.
Keep your jewellery and accessories simple.

Each piece is made with love by Maryanne, using an Apoxie Clay and then she hand sets each of the Swarovski Chatons (ie. the crystals).
My Beaded Designs original Swarovski PAW Print Necklace was designed and created almost 3 years ago. The very first PAW Print necklace was donated to Urban Cat Relief (UCR) in memory of a kitten that volunteers tried to save, but couldn’t. Maryanne spent quite some time trying to figure out how to create something beautiful as a memory of such a sad event. Many tears were shed while Maryanne was making this first piece. And ever since that dreadful day when that kitten passed, she was determined to help UCR raise money so that they can do what they do best. Since that time she’s been able to create and donate to Cuddly Cats Rescue and Sanctuary and several other animal rescues and causes – donating $5 from the sale of every Swarovski PAW Print Necklace. And she is now proudly known among these communities as “The PAW lady” :).
